Black Canyon (ASX:BCA) has obtained further positive manganese metallurgical testwork results from the Wandanya project in Western Australia.

Following up on the initial stage one crush, sizing and assay metallurgical testwork across multiple diamond drill core composites, the latest sighter level metallurgical program has demonstrated key benefits of the mineralisation at Wandanya, including the suitability of all the manganese oxide composites to beneficiate with the application of a simple density-based separation technique.

The test results matched high-quality, low-impurity content product specification with more than 70% of the manganese grade and recoveries produced from the fractions over 8.0mm, which is positive for producing a lump-size product.

Black Canyon is confident it now has multiple options for developing a final product strategy. MD, Brendan Cummins, said more testwork will assist in developing the conceptual operating and processing strategies.

“Continuing on from the positive crush and sizing analysis, the beneficiation testwork applied to the manganese oxide composites have yet again delivered strong results for the project,” Mr Cummins told shareholders today.

“Most of the manganese product grades from the beneficiated low, medium and high-grade composites were close to or over 40% manganese, showing the amenability of the mineralisation to upgrade using simple density-based methods.”

He continued: “The important takeaway from the metallurgical testwork program is the quality and grade of the manganese oxide product that could potentially be produced from Wandanya. Potential end users remain very interested in our product specifications as we continue to move the project forward through exploration, resource definition and pre-development activities.”

The geometallurgical characteristics will be important as Black Canton examines processing options to inform potential flowsheet design and cost estimates for a planned scoping level economic analysis later in CY26.

“Having a well-informed mining and processing strategy is a key objective as we develop the Wandanya project,” Mr Cummins said.

With the completion of stage two heavy liquid separation (HLS) testwork, the company is planning additional HLS in preparation for larger-scale DMS.

Mr Cummins said the additional HLS testwork will examine blended feeds combining low, medium and high-grade Mn composites in ratios reflecting the current geometallurgical understanding of the discovery.

Black Canyon is currently testing iron lump samples for strength, durability, and degradation characteristics under impact using drop tower tests.

At the conclusion, the data will be reviewed, and conceptual flowsheets will be designed for Scoping Level cost estimates. Further larger-scale testwork using more diamond drill core or bulk samples from pits to be excavated from the site is being considered once the deposit has been drilled out.
